Ingredients

1lbground beef,90% lean

1tspgarlic,minced

¼cupparmesan cheese,finely grated

¼cupbreadcrumbs

1egg

1tspkosher salt

½tspground black pepper

¼cupmilk

cooking spray

2cupsmarinara sauce

2cupsmozzarella cheese,shredded

2tbspparsley,chopped

Preparation

In a large bowl, combine the ground beef, garlic, parmesan cheese, breadcrumbs, egg, salt, pepper, and milk. Mix together until thoroughly blended.

Preheat the broiler. Coat the bottom of a 9 or 10-inch skillet with cooking spray.

Form the meatballs into approximately 1½ inches in diameter, then place the meatballs in a single layer in the pan.

Broil for 8 to 10 minutes or until the meatballs are cooked through and browned on top. Drain off any fat or liquid in the pan.

Pour the marinara sauce over the meatballs, then sprinkle the cheese over the sauce.

Broil for 3 to 5 minutes or until the cheese is melted and browned.

Sprinkle with parsley, serve, and enjoy!
